Nokia 3120 Review
The Nokia 3120 comes complete with great messaging services which include MMS messaging (multimedia message service) which allows the user to send text, images & audio all in one message which is very simple to create. The phone provides the user with delivery reports for all MMS & SMS (text messages) that are sent from the 3120.
The user can purchase the Nokia Fun Camera enhancement which offers the user the ability to take snaps which can be saved or shared with friends using the MMS message service.



The 3120 comes with a really fun feature that allows the user to see a flash light displayed when a call comes in & this really brings the Nokia 3120 to life. The mobile phone includes polyphonic ringing tones which provide a quality sound. The calendar, alarm clock, stopwatch, countdown timer & calculator are very useful features that will keep the user organised.
Nokia 3120 Specifications & Features
Screen
4096 Colour Screen (128 x 128 Pixels)
Imaging
Fun Camera (Optional Extra)
Screensavers
Wallpapers
Rhythmic Backlight Alert
Display Brightness Control
Lights Flash When Phone Rings
Incoming & Outgoing Call Animation
Messaging
SMS (Text Messaging)
MMS (Multimedia Messaging)
Predictive Text
Delivery Reports
Sound
Polyphonic Ringtones
Entertainment
Embedded Java™ Games
Snake EX2 Game
Beach Rally Game
Bowling Game

Organiser
Phonebook
Calendar
Alarm Clock
Stopwatch
Countdown Timer
Calculator
Connectivity
Pop-Port™
USB
Network
Tri Band (GSM 900, GSM 1800 & GSM 1900)
Internet
GPRS
WAP
Memory & Talk Time
4 Mbytes Memory
6 Hours Talk Time
410 Hours Standby
Weight & Size
84 g
101.8 x 42.6 x 19.4 mm

Reviewer: Srilok And. Rath - New Delhi, India
Date: 21st Dec 2006
I purchased 3120 keeping in mind the requirements listed below.
My requirements primarily were:
1. Good battery, long talk & standby time.
2. Good speaker.
3. Triband.
4. Colour screen.
5. Light weight.
6. Gprs.
I have been using the handset for last 4 months & very satisfied with the performance.
Once charged I get maximum 4.5 hours of talk time & the battery lasts for minimum 72 hours, with 3 - 4 hours of talking.
The resolution of the screen is a bit dull compared with other phones available in the same price range.
My toddler son has dropped it, more than 10 times, both accidentally & deliberately. But still it works fine.
The reception is good despite bit fluctuating signal strength in my multi storied apartment. The voice quality overall is good but at times there is a mild humming sound in the voice. The speaker is loud, voice does not crack & audible from quite a distance.
The layout of the keys & size is good. It is not bulky & looks wise it's sleek. Carrying it is easy, as it weighs 85 grams. It is easy to use but not as user friendly or feature rich as non - Nokia cell phones.
The back cover is bit delicate.
Overall it's a good cell - provided if you use it for long conversations & don't expect much in terms of features I.e. radio, storing MMS clips, etc.
